The Agile Advantage: Why MVP Development Agencies Embrace Flexibility
The Agile Advantage: Why MVP Development Agencies Embrace Flexibility
Share:


Introduction

In the ever-evolving landscape of software development, Minimum Viable Product (MVP) development agencies have become pivotal players. The essence of MVP is to create a product with just enough features to satisfy early adopters and provide feedback for future development. This concept inherently demands adaptability, making the adoption of agile methodologies almost natural. This article explores why MVP development agencies embrace flexibility and how this adaptability offers a significant advantage in today’s fast-paced digital ecosystem.

Understanding Agile Methodologies

Agile methodologies are a set of principles for software development under which requirements and solutions evolve through the collaborative effort of cross-functional teams. By promoting development, teamwork, collaboration, and process adaptability, agile methodologies enable teams to deliver quickly and efficiently. Central to agile development are iterative processes divided into small, manageable cycles known as sprints. This fosters an environment where quick adjustments can be made in response to stakeholder feedback or changes in market conditions.

The MVP Approach

The MVP approach centers around the idea of building only the essential features of a product and releasing it to a target audience. By doing so, businesses can gather valuable feedback and make informed decisions on future iterations. MVPs are cost-effective and reduce the risk of developing features that are not needed or wanted by the end-users. This lean approach to product development is similar in philosophy to the agile mindset, where flexibility and adaptability are cherished values.

Flexibility in Agile MVP Development

Flexibility is the cornerstone of agile methodologies and a crucial component of MVP development. In an agile MVP development environment, teams can rapidly pivot or iterate upon receiving new data or user feedback, ensuring that the end product aligns more closely with user needs and market demands. Agile’s flexibility allows development teams to manage uncertainty effectively. As a result, MVP development agencies can deliver products more aligned with real-world usage without extensive investment in a single iteration.

Benefits of Embracing Agile for MVP Development

1. Faster Time to Market: Agile enables MVP development agencies to deliver products quickly, ensuring a competitive edge by getting products in front of users faster than traditional development cycles.

2. Improved Product Quality: The continuous feedback loop in agile development improves product quality. Regular testing within each sprint allows for the early discovery and resolution of issues, enhancing the final output.

3. Customer-Centric Approach: Agile methodologies foster a customer-centric approach, as frequent updates and iterations are driven by user feedback. This continuous engagement ensures that the product remains aligned with user expectations and requirements.

4. Risk Management: With agile’s iterative nature, risks are minimized. Smaller, incremental updates allow for easier identification and management of potential risks, thereby reducing the chance of project failures.

5. Enhanced Collaboration and Transparency: Agile promotes a culture of collaboration and openness. Teams work closely with stakeholders, ensuring transparency and trust throughout the development process.

Challenges and Considerations

While agile presents numerous advantages, MVP development agencies must also navigate several challenges. Agile requires a shift in mindset, which can be difficult for teams accustomed to traditional methodologies. In addition, there can be a tendency to focus too much on short-term goals, overlooking long-term strategic planning.

Agencies must also consider the potential for scope creep as flexible approaches sometimes lead to the continuous addition of features without proper evaluation. Effective communication and clear guidelines are critical to mitigating these risks.

Real-World Applications and Success Stories

Numerous MVP development agencies have demonstrated the benefits of adopting agile methodologies. For instance, successful startups often begin with an MVP grounded in agile principles, iterating rapidly based on user feedback, which drives growth and market success.

Companies like Spotify and Airbnb have harnessed the power of agile MVP development to refine their products continuously based on real-time data and user interactions. These case studies highlight that flexibility not only provides operational advantages but also builds a strong foundation for innovation.

The Future of Agile in MVP Development

As the software development landscape continues to evolve, the principles of agility and flexibility will remain critical. The shift towards remote work and global teams further emphasizes the need for agile methodologies that empower MVP development agencies to adapt swiftly to a rapidly changing environment.

Emerging technologies, such as AI and machine learning, also promise to enhance agile processes, providing more sophisticated tools for analyzing user behavior and automating routine tasks. This evolution will further cement agile’s role in the development of innovative and successful products.

Conclusion

Agile methodologies have transformed the way MVP development agencies operate, bringing a significant edge in flexibility and efficiency. By embracing agile principles, these agencies are better equipped to respond to market demands, enhance customer satisfaction, and drive innovation.

The ability to adapt and iterate rapidly not only reduces time to market but also ensures that products meet the real needs of users, resulting in greater success rates. As the industry continues to evolve, the role of agility will only grow in importance, redefining how products are developed and delivered.